Roku, Tivo, Microsoft On The Future Of TV

At SD Forum’s event on Digital Media, media expert Jimmy Schaeffler of the Carmel Group asked executives from Roku, Tivo and Microsoft their vision about the future of television.

Timothy Twerdahl, Vice President of Consumer Products at Roku

For Timothy Twerdahl, Vice President of Consumer Products at Roku it’s all about the cloud:

“Our vision is that the community is going to help us figure this out. So we have this open SDK and people are going to create channels they are interested in, local things they want to know and we’ll see what gets picked up… [The future of TV] is not DVR or streamed DV, but everything in the cloud, not necessarily at a head-end but really at the service provider that owns the content and is going to distribute it.”

Jim Denney, Vice President, Product Marketing at TiVo

For Jim Denney, Vice President, Product Marketing at TiVo it’s search:

“One of the critical points is being able to allow people to sort through all the content choice that they have, and do that quickly and simply. Getting people the content that they want is going to be a hot topic.”

Christine Heckart, General Manager Marketing at Microsoft TV

For Christine Heckart, General Manager Marketing at Microsoft TV it’s the experience:

“The future of television is an all on-demand experience that scale, and you get what you want, when and on the device where you want to have it, wherever you happen to be in the world.”
